Jeff Vines discusses the significance of the biblical feasts, particularly Rosh Hashanah and Yom Kippur, in understanding God's judgment and mercy. He emphasises that these feasts are prophetic and tied to major events in Jesus' life, highlighting the importance of repentance and the seriousness of sin. Vines encourages listeners to approach God with a collective spirit of confession and to recognise the need for personal and communal repentance as they prepare for Easter.

He warns that unrepentant sin can lead to judgment and urges individuals to take action against sin in their lives. Vines concludes with a call for revival, emphasising that true repentance is essential for experiencing God's presence and blessings.
